Fearing isolation, the BCCI has stated that it had no problems with the ICC or the WADA over the drug testing situation. The reason they are standing behind the Indian cricketers is because they cannot afford to compromise the security measures of a couple of cricketers.

Apparently Sachin Tendulkar and Mahendra Singh Dhoni, the Indian captain, are on high security alert and the players, as the players have been victim of threats from extremist groups. Earlier, security was beefed up for Sachin Tendulkar as well as Sourav Ganguly for a similar purpose.
In such a scenario, players state they are simply not comfortable stating their whereabouts and the BCCI certainly does not want to be the first to compromise the players' security.
